what is lunar dust made of??? please help me out here!!

Respuesta :

arabellacruz009
arabellacruz009 arabellacruz009
  • 03-06-2019

Answer: Lunar dust is made up of silicates

Explanation: 42% oxygen

21% silicon

13% iron

8% calcium

7% aluminium

6% magnesium
